Lee, Massachusetts

Lee is a town in Berkshire County, Massachusetts, United States. It is part of the Pittsfield, Massachusetts Metropolitan Statistical Area. The population was 5,985 at the 2000 census. Lee Careers

Among the most common occupations in Lee are Sales and office occupations, 38%. Management, professional, and related occupations, 30%. and Service occupations, 16%. Approximately 76 percent of workers in Lee, Massachusetts work for companies, 16 percent work for the government and 5 percent are self-employed.

Lee Industries

The leading industries in Lee, Massachusetts are Educational, health and social services, 28%; Retail trade, 15%; and Arts, entertainment, recreation, accommodation and food services, 12%.
